• Can you really install a woodstove in your home without violating any law?
As a general rule, you cannot. Installing a wood stove for example, should be known by your insurance company if your home is insured so that you will not be liable of breach. You should inform your insurance company so that in any case or any unfortunate event like fire, burning down your home, the damage will still be covered by your insurance, otherwise it will not be covered. Now, if you are really decided to install homemade wood stove. I know you are asking how to install a wood stove. Follow these tips on how to install a wood stove:
1. You should remember that every wood stove should have a chimney. If you have one, no problem but if you don’t have a chimney, make one first;
2. After the chimney, make a stove pipe. This stove pipe is used to connect your wood stove to your chimney. Usually, the stove pipe should be eighteen (18”) inches from a wall or ceiling; and finally
3. Your flooring should be non-combustible and your wall should have a rear heat shield on the wood stove or you can just install wall protection properly.
